Senior CPI leader Atul Kumar Anjaan passes away

Lucknow, May 3 (Reporter) Senior Communist Party of India (CPI) leader Atul Kumar Anjaan passed away after prolonged illness at a private hospital in Lucknow on Friday. He was 69. Party sources said Anjaan was battling with cancer for a long time and was admitted to a private hospital for the last one month. Anjaan was serving as national secretary of the CPI for a long time.Besides, he served as the national general secretary of All India Kisan Sabha. He started his career as student leader and was elected as the president of the Lucknow University Students Union from where he rose to prominence. Paying tribute to CPI leader on X, Rashtriya Lok Dal chief Jayant Singh wrote, "I am shocked by the demise of Atul Kumar Anjan ji. He was a brave and dedicated public servant.
